Autocom is a Swedish company that established itself as a leader in multi-brand diagnostic tools. Unlike dealer-specific tools (like Techstream for Toyota or INPA for BMW), Autocom offered a single interface that could communicate with hundreds of different vehicle makes.

Autocom is a professional diagnostic system for cars, trucks, and motorcycles. It reads and clears fault codes, displays live data, performs actuation tests, and supports coding and programming functions. Version 2011.1 was released around 2011 and was widely used with the Autocom CDP (Cars, Diagnostic, Professional) series hardware, including CDP+, CDP Pro, and compatible Delphi DS150E clones.
Key features of Autocom 2011.1:
Despite its age, some workshops still run 2011.1 because it’s stable, light on resources, and works with older clone interfaces that are no longer supported by newer software versions.

1. The Malware Risk Torrent sites hosting cracked software are a primary vector for malware. Unscrupulous actors often bundle the diagnostic software with keyloggers, ransomware, or trojans. Because users attempting to install this software are often disabling their antivirus protection to run "keygens" or cracks, they leave their systems highly vulnerable.
2. Firmware Bricking Cracked versions of Autocom 2011.1 often come with instructions to "flash" or update the firmware on the diagnostic interface. If the user has a cheap clone interface and attempts to update the firmware using software meant for genuine hardware (or poorly coded crack files), it can permanently "brick" the device, rendering it useless.
3. Driver Instability Getting 2011.1 to run on modern operating systems like Windows 10 or 11 is a challenge. The software was built for Windows XP and Windows 7. Torrent downloads rarely come with reliable technical support. Users often spend days troubleshooting driver conflicts, Bluetooth pairing issues, and "Interface not found" errors.
